Output dddb3ca7fa1dc1708a1f956ec7afc2c4a38543e2c880cdbf64bc3daf8347c1aa:0

value
600000
script pubkey
OP_0 OP_PUSHBYTES_20 ef6eaa180f783d4a88034cabd9cb5527abe9ee30
address
bc1qaah25xq00q754zqrfj4anj64y747nm3s5fp54x
transaction
dddb3ca7fa1dc1708a1f956ec7afc2c4a38543e2c880cdbf64bc3daf8347c1aa
confirmations
178370
spent
true